> > Before I write off the HP Scanjet 4100c, I thought it's
> > best to check with the list first.
> >
> > I have "device usb" in the kernel; I did a kernel load of
> > uscanner.ko and a kldstat shows that the module is there.
> > My two USB ports seem to be alive. Is there a command to
> > double-check??
>
> two commands to try :
>
> scanimage -L
> sane-find-scanner
>
> (you might want to try this as root if you don't find anything as a
> normal user, after (scanner is found) that fix permissions)
